218: Paul Schmit - A Nuclear Physicist's Views on Landscape Photography

Welcome to episode 218 of F-Stop Collaborate and Listen! This week on the podcast I was joined by a nuclear physicist and night photographer extraordinaire, Paul Schmit. Paul is one of the first people I became aware of using an interesting night photography technique known as Deepscapes, which we talk about on this week's show. He's also a father of two and is busy working on a way to provide the world with nearly limitless energy through nuclear fusion and so we discuss the interplay of his science life, his family life, and his photography life. Paul and I also discuss: Why he has chosen night photography as his main photography passion. How he captured the International Space Station transiting across the rising sun. How he approaches composition of deep sky objects as related to landscape objects. Why he values a more authentic approach to chasing and capturing the night sky. And HEAPS more! This photography podcast takes you well beyond camera gear each week with weekly interviews and panel discussions with professional photographers, industry insiders, enthusiasts, and hobbyists alike. Our candid but laid-back conversations deeply explore the craft of photography, and psychological drivers relating to creativity, motivation, inspiration, and workflow. We also discuss social media, photography business practices, marketing, sales, and hot topics impacting photographers from all genres, with a particular focus on landscape, nature, and wildlife photography. The show is hosted by Matt Payne, a professional full-time nature photographer and the co-founder of the internationally renowned photography competition, the Natural Landscape Photography Awards. Matt is also a mountaineer, climbing the highest 100 mountains in Colorado. Matt leverages skills he gained in pursuit of his Master’s Degree in Clinical Psychology to dig deeply into the hearts and minds of his passionate guests, revealing secrets and inspiration in every episode.
